hyoromoのブログ

最近はVRSNS向けに作ったものについて書いています

Cocos2d-x v3.3向けのXcodeテンプレート導入

f:id:hyoromo:20150208111809j:plain

Xcodeで新規ファイル作成する際、以下を継承したCocos2dx向けファイルを生成してくれるようになります。

  • 継承なし
  • Layer継承
  • LayerColor継承
  • Node継承

導入手順

  1. 以下からファイルをダウンロード
    https://onedrive.live.com/redir?resid=2cd69f09dd371380%213568
  2. 以下のディレクトリに解凍したファイルを配置
    /Users/ユーザ名/Library/Developer/Xcode/Templates/File Templates/
  3. 配置したファイルが以下のようになっている事を確認
    /Users/ユーザ名/Library/Developer/Xcode/Templates/File Templates/Cocos2d-x v3.3/xxxxx.xctemplate

これで完了です。

使い方

1. Xcodeから「New File...」でファイル追加
2. ポップアップ画面のサイドメニューから「Cocos2d-x v3.3」を選択
3. 必要に応じて4種類の中から選択して「Next」

拡張方法

以下をコピペで増やして中身のコード弄れば好きに追加出来ますし、既存テンプレの改造も出来ます。
/Users/ユーザ名/Library/Developer/Xcode/Templates/File Templates/Cocos2d-x v3.3/xxxxx.xctemplate

参考リンク

本内容のベースはDevelopers.IOさんの以下ブログ記事に紹介されている内容です。アプリ開発しながら自分の都合の良いように形を変えたのが今回アップした内容となっています。
Developers.IOさん記事にある方が汎用性が高いので、ますはそちらを確認してから私が公開したテンプレを使うか検討された方が良いかもしれません。[Cocos2d-x]Cocos2d-x Ver3.0 テンプレートを使ってスムーズに開発する[iOS][Android] | Developers.IO